  • Patent number: 5335190
    Abstract: An inclinometer 300 includes a sensing unit 302 for providing a signal dependent on the orientation of the inclinometer 300. The inclinometer 300 includes a rescaling unit 322 which improves the performance of the inclinometer providing additional compensation for any change in the sensor 302 over time and temperature. The inclinometer 300 further includes an angle offset function 91, 360 which provides a permanent angle offset to any angle determined by the inclinometer.

  • Patent number: 5134780
    Abstract: An inclinometer 20 includes a module 22 which is mounted to a rail 32. The rail 32 has a hollow I-shaped cross-section which affords substantial resistance to torsional and bending loads about the longitudinal axis 34 of the inclinometer 20. The rail 32 and in particular a first end 36 of the I-shaped cross-section includes first and second curves 48, 50 which define lobes which provide a rail design more suitable for gripping and placement by the user.

  • Patent number: 4912662
    Abstract: An inclinometer 20 has a sensing unit 40 for providing a varying capacitance signal depending on the orientation of the inclinometer 20. An oscillator circuit unit 82 includes the sensor unit 40 as a capacitive element for providing a signal having a period and a frequency depending on the capacitance of the sensor unit 40. A unit 92 is provided for determining the period of the signal. A look-up table unit 96 stores a predetermined relationship between the period of the signal and the angle of orientation of the inclinometer 20. A comparison unit 94 then compares the period of the signal to the period stored in the look-up table unit 96 and selects the corresponding angle which is the angle of orientation of the inclinometer 20. The angle is then displayed on the inclinometer display 25.
